Hi, I am new to SAS and would like some help in filtering this set of data from bankscope which has a problem with duplications. There are instances where a certain bank in a certain year has 3 rows of financial data, hence there is a need to remove/delete duplicates according to the following priority of filtering - C1/C2, C*, U1/U2, U*. From table 1 to table 2.
Table 1
| Year | ISIN | Name | Consolidation code |
| 2000 | Uk123 | ABC | C1 |
| 2000 | Uk123 | ABC | C* |
| 2000 | Uk123 | ABC | U1 |
| 2001 | Uk123 | ABC | C2 |
| 2001 | Uk123 | ABC | U1 |
| 2001 | UK345 | DEF | U1 |
| 2001 | UK345 | DEF | C* |
| 2002 | UK345 | DEF | U* |
Table 2
| Year | ISIN | Name | Consolidation code |
| 2000 | Uk123 | ABC | C1 |
| 2001 | Uk123 | ABC | C2 |
| 2001 | UK345 | DEF | C* |
